Try combining two of the variants on the EU board:

- The Improved Grand Campaign; and

- The Holland - Grand Campaign.

The Holland variant separates the Holland province from Spain, turning it into the duchy of Gelre/Gelderland, which was independent in 1492 (though re-absorbed by Charles V a couple of decades after the game begins).

You'll need to edit the files, though, to do this. But it's certainly different from Turkey. If the warfare aspect was what you enjoyed about Turkey, though, be warned, this variant will start a bit slow - and you should be avoiding war, initially. Move things along at the 1 minute=2 years speed until the Reformation, when things'll get more interesting.

I've found it's actually pretty easy to get a whole bunch of maps without any exploring. What you need to do is trade your european map with one of the north african sultinates to get the middle eastern map, the trade that to one of the exploring powers. With that, you can become middleman between the different great nations, getting explored provinces from one then trading them with another, then tradeing those to yet another. Failing that, build twenty ship and go crush small enemy fleets to get maps.

If you're up for a challenge, Prussia. I've managed to still keep my BB value relatively low, while becoming THE dominant power in the East, going from 1 province to ~30 with 4 COTs by the 1520's.

Other fun countries, I imagine, would be Navarra, Helvetia, and Holand. You simply need a major power near you, so your BB value won't go up too much in your expansion.

As for maps, you just have to sack some Western major power's capitol - with Scotland, you have England right next to you .
